首页 > 编程知识 正文

四类运算符的优先级,运算符优先级由高到低c语言

时间:2023-05-03 09:01:05 阅读:40468 作者:3402

运算符用于执行程序代码运算,对多个操作数项进行运算。 例如,2 3的操作数为2和3,运算符为“”。

运算符的优先级从上到下依次减少,顶部具有最高优先级,逗号运算符具有最低优先级。 表达式的合并顺序取决于表达式中各种运算符的优先级。 高优先级运算符先合并,低优先级运算符后合并,同一行中的运算符具有相同的优先级。

数据扩展

优先顺序与评价顺序无关。 像a b b*c那样,*优先顺序最高,但该式的评价顺序从左到右。

优先级从上到下依次减少,顶部具有最高优先级,逗号操作符具有最低优先级。

在相同的优先顺序中,以结合性结合。 大多数运算符结合性从左到右,从右到左结合的只有三个优先级:单眼运算符、条件运算符和赋值运算符。

指针最好,单眼运算优于双目运算。 就像符号一样。 先算术运算,后移位运算,最后位运算。 请特别注意。 1 3 2 7等于(1) 32 ) ) 7。 逻辑运算最后结合。

来源:百度百科-运算符优先级

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。